What EV Charger Installation Includes
Here's what a licensed Bendale electrician covers during a typical ev charger installation appointment:
- Dedicated 240V/50A circuit run from the main panel to the garage or carport
- Level 2 EVSE (charger) mounting and hardwire or NEMA 14-50 outlet installation
- Conduit installation where exposed wiring is required
- City permit and inspection coordination (required in most jurisdictions)
- Smart charger setup and app pairing (if applicable)
- Post-installation test: vehicle plugged in and charging confirmed
Scope may vary by contractor. Ask your licensed electrician to confirm what's included before work begins.
How EV Charger Installation Works in Bendale
What to expect from a licensed Bendale electrician from first call to completion.
- 1
Site Assessment
The electrician inspects your panel capacity and locates the best route for the 240V circuit from panel to garage or carport.
- 2
Permit Application
A permit is required for all new circuits. Most jurisdictions require inspection before the charger is used.
- 3
Circuit Installation
A dedicated 50A/240V circuit is run from the panel, through conduit if exposed, to the garage. A NEMA 14-50 outlet or hardwired EVSE is installed.
- 4
Charger Mounting & Wiring
The Level 2 EVSE is mounted, wired, and connected. Smart charger app pairing is completed if applicable.
- 5
Test & Inspection
Vehicle is plugged in and charging is confirmed. City inspector verifies the installation before the permit is closed.

What is aluminum wiring and is it dangerous?
Aluminum branch circuit wiring installed in Bendale and similar humid continental-region homes built between 1965–1973 is a documented fire hazard per safety testing standards. Aluminum corrodes at connection points, creating heat buildup that sparks fires. Remediation requires either pigtailing (copper connections to outlets) or full rewire to modern copper wiring per the Canadian Electrical Code (CEC). How do I know if my electrical panel needs to be replaced?
Replace your electrical panel in Bendale immediately if breakers trip repeatedly, you smell burning plastic, the panel is under 200 amps, it's over 30–40 years old, or it's a defective brand (Zinsco, Federal Pacific, Pushmatic). An ESA-certified electrician in Bendale inspects panels for CAD $150–CAD $300. Signs of danger include rust, corrosion, or loose wiring inside the panel.
